School of Economics and Management, University of MinhoVANESSA FRAGA

Ph.D. Student in Administrative Sciences, University of Minho

Ph.D. student in Administrative Sciences at University of Minho – Braga, Portugal (2017-2020). Master in Administration from the Graduate School of the Universidade Regional de Blumenau (2007), graduated in Administration from the University of Southern Santa Catarina (2013), graduated in Technology in Public Administration from the University of Southern Santa Catarina (2012) and graduated in Bilingual Executive Secretariat by the Fundação Universidade Regional de Blumenau (2004). Vanessa is currently developing scientific research on the role of changing administrative burdens as well as the level of stakeholder participation (street level bureaucrats and citizens) in perceptions of willingness for a participatory policy change, researching the Brazilian social security reality. Vanessa worked as an online tutor at the School of Public Administration (ENAP) and at the INSS Training and Improvement Center (CFAI), as well as teacher at private HEIs. Vanessa is a Social Security Technician of the National Social Service Institute (INSS) and is currently with exclusive dedication to the doctorate programme in Portugal. She has teaching experience in Public and Private Administration, with emphasis on Strategic Management, Governance and Sustainability.
